Scabior actor Moran reveals some Death Eater scenes cut because they resembled Saw

Nick Moran, the actor who plays Scabior the Snatcher, in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ows has revealed in a new interview that some scenes were cut because they were too gory.

“The scenes I did were really, really dark, really, really dark, but when I went to see them they cut some of the worst bits out, and I was talking to producer David Heyman, saying, ‘Oh no, why’s that gone?’ He said, apparently it was like watching Saw.”

Moran added how much he’s enjoyed being a part of the series and joked about the script:

“It’s been brilliant. I’m the new baddie in the Harry Potter film. I can’t really give too much away – it’s hilarious, because your script has a watermark in it. It says a number, which is on every page, so that if you lose it, everyone knows it was you. So it’s all top secret.”.
